About the role
Part 2 Architectural Assistant – Part 3 Support – Shipley
Circa £32,000
Are you a talented Part 2 Architectural Assistant looking to build your experience across a diverse range of projects while receiving full support towards your Part 3 qualification?
Our client is a well-established architectural and interior design practice with over 35 years of experience delivering inspiring commercial and residential projects throughout the UK. Known for their creative approach, technical expertise and long-standing client relationships, they have built an enviable reputation for delivering high-quality projects across a range of sectors.
Due to continued growth, they are seeking an ambitious Part 2 Architectural Assistant to join their friendly and collaborative team in Shipley.
The Opportunity
This is an excellent opportunity to gain hands-on experience across RIBA Stages 1–4 while working on a varied portfolio of projects including hospitality, residential, commercial, industrial and heritage schemes.
The practice undertakes refurbishment, extension and conversion projects for blue-chip hospitality clients, many involving existing and Listed Buildings, alongside residential developments, bespoke homes and interior design commissions.
As part of a close-knit team, you'll enjoy genuine responsibility, working directly alongside experienced architects and designers while developing both your technical and creative skills.
Responsibilities
* Assisting with projects across RIBA Stages 1–4
* Producing planning and Building Regulations packages
* Preparing design and technical drawings
* Liaising with clients, consultants and local authorities
* Assisting with tender and construction information
* Supporting architectural and interior design projects
About You
* RIBA Part 2 qualified
* Ideally 2+ years' experience within an architectural practice
* Experience working across RIBA Stages 1–4
* Good understanding of planning and Building Regulations processes
* Strong communication and organisational skills
* Proactive, enthusiastic and keen to develop your career
* An interest in interior design would be advantageous
What's on Offer?
* Salary circa £32,000
* Full support and mentoring towards Part 3 qualification
* Exposure to a wide variety of project sectors
* Experience working on Listed Buildings and heritage projects
* Friendly and supportive team environment
* Genuine long-term career progression
* Established and respected Yorkshire practice
